Creating our horror trailer we used different programs to construct, research, plan and evaluate. The majority of our construction and research was done on a Mac Computer.  This media technology was actually very useful, because it had a variety of programs that we could use to construct our media trailer on. The only disadvantage is due to the software, which we have only used in the past year, there were some difficulties we found. Mac Computers though did allow us to be more creative by using Photoshop and other programs featured in Adobe. For example when creating typography to be used in the trailer, the program Adobe – After Effects challenged me in a way where I had taught myself the how to use different layers to create text across the screen, and add effects onto the text by using compositions. Using Mac Computers were also useful so we could keep updated with our blogs and start a new entry each time, which helped with our planning and research.  


Another program we used was Celtx. This program on the Macs helped us create our screenplay for the trailer in a formal structure. It was useful in the way it helped us organise the characters lines better and stage actions that were to be filmed. Celtx also came with ‘Master Catalog’ that allowed us to write detailed descriptions of each character. This was helpful in the construction part of our trailer. Also to our advantage it was straight forward to use.

In order to actually construct our trailer we used digital cameras. This was interesting for me because I’ve never used a professional camera before so it was something new. The different camera focus’ and lenses were interesting to use in our trailer because we could change the lense according to the shot being shown. However, because these features were new to us we found certain buttons confusing to use.
